Output 89de410db806c8554eea18aa3db7d25845980716eae8eaf2003e86e39eb87e92:4

value
159272482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5c721d334418e3369611e304c5e6518792c3c5 OP_EQUAL
address
3GDe7HhLAwg82o3DA63VWmiTvsBmousrDN
transaction
89de410db806c8554eea18aa3db7d25845980716eae8eaf2003e86e39eb87e92
spent
true